Incredible speeds to get the job doneWith a blazing 7400MB/s sequential read, 6500MB/s sequential write1 and random read speeds of up to 1,000,000 IOPs, the Lexar® NM790 SSD has the performance to put you across the finish line first or easily meet your most demanding deadlines.
Twice as fast
At 2x as fast as PCIe Gen3 SSDs2, the Lexar® NM790 M.2 2280 PCIe Gen 4×4 NVMe SSD helps you perform at your best, fast.

Premium (Grade A): Excellent Cosmetic Condition- May have some very minor scratches/ Scuff marks on the back and/or chassis, including general wear and tear around the ports. These mobile phones are just like new, they have minimal, if any signs of use and are fully functional. The difference between a A Grade phone and a new phone is usually the lack of the original box and/or accessories.
Great (Grade B): Good Condition- May have some minor scratches or scuffs. This grade is given to used mobile phones that carry signs of use. There is a possibility of the phone having minor scratches or scuffs on the screen and/or housing (the Back to you and me) including general wear and tear around the ports. This is a fully functional phone. Again the difference between a grade B phone and a new phone is the lack of the original box and/or accessories.
Fair (Grade C): Average Cosmetic Condition- Will have some scratch marks and or signs of use. This grade is given to used mobile phones with signs of regular use. There is a high
possibility that mobile phones of this grade will come with scratches and/or scruff marks.
